A chemical reaction is defined as the reaction that leads to formation of new substances through exchange of electrons.
For example,

Here, aluminium on displacing copper from copper chloride leads to the formation of a new compound, that is, aluminium chloride.
Hence, it shows that atoms of reactant molecules rearrange themselves to form new substances.
Thus, we can conclude that during a chemical reaction atoms of reactants rearrange to form new substances .
